Project Consultant Jobs in North Carolina: Frequently Asked Questions

Which companies sponsor visas for project consultants in North Carolina?

Consulting firms with significant North Carolina footprints, including Deloitte, IBM, Accenture, and Booz Allen Hamilton, have consistent records of sponsoring H-1B visas for project consultant roles. Life sciences contractors such as Syneos Health and IQVIA, both headquartered in the Research Triangle, also sponsor international consultants. Large financial institutions in Charlotte, including Bank of America and Wells Fargo, hire project consultants and have active sponsorship programs.

Which visa types are most common for project consultant roles in North Carolina?

The H-1B is the most common visa category for project consultants in North Carolina, provided the role qualifies as a specialty occupation requiring at least a bachelor's degree in a specific field such as business, engineering, or information technology. L-1B visas apply to intracompany transfers with specialized knowledge, which is relevant for consultants moving from a parent company's overseas office to a North Carolina practice.

Which cities in North Carolina have the most project consultant sponsorship jobs?

Raleigh and Durham, anchored by the Research Triangle Park, concentrate the highest volume of project consultant sponsorship opportunities in North Carolina, particularly in technology, life sciences, and government contracting. Charlotte is the second major market, driven by its finance and operations consulting sector. Smaller but active markets include Greensboro, where logistics and manufacturing consulting firms recruit, and Chapel Hill, adjacent to UNC's research ecosystem.

Are there state-specific considerations for project consultants seeking visa sponsorship in North Carolina?

North Carolina's Research Triangle Park is one of the largest research and technology parks in the United States, creating concentrated demand for project consultants in biotech, IT, and government contracting, sectors where H-1B sponsorship is relatively common. Employers must meet Department of Labor prevailing wage requirements tied to the specific job location, so wages for Research Triangle Park positions may differ from those in Charlotte or smaller metros. Universities like NC State and UNC also generate pipelines of OPT-eligible consultants that employers in the region are accustomed to hiring.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ored project consultant jobs in North Carolina?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
